void Graphics::SetShaderParameter(StringHash param, const Variant& value)
{
    switch (value.GetType())
    {
    case VAR_BOOL:
        SetShaderParameter(param, value.GetBool());
        break;

    case VAR_INT:
        SetShaderParameter(param, value.GetInt());
        break;

    case VAR_FLOAT:
    case VAR_DOUBLE:
        SetShaderParameter(param, value.GetFloat());
        break;

    case VAR_VECTOR2:
        SetShaderParameter(param, value.GetVector2());
        break;

    case VAR_VECTOR3:
        SetShaderParameter(param, value.GetVector3());
        break;

    case VAR_VECTOR4:
        SetShaderParameter(param, value.GetVector4());
        break;

    case VAR_COLOR:
        SetShaderParameter(param, value.GetColor());
        break;

    case VAR_MATRIX3:
        SetShaderParameter(param, value.GetMatrix3());
        break;

    case VAR_MATRIX3X4:
        SetShaderParameter(param, value.GetMatrix3x4());
        break;

    case VAR_MATRIX4:
        SetShaderParameter(param, value.GetMatrix4());
        break;

    case VAR_BUFFER:
        {
            const PODVector<unsigned char>& buffer = value.GetBuffer();
            if (buffer.Size() >= sizeof(float))
                SetShaderParameter(param, reinterpret_cast<const float*>(&buffer[0]), buffer.Size() / sizeof(float));
        }
        break;

    default:
        // Unsupported parameter type, do nothing
        break;
    }
}

bool Serializer::WriteVariantData(const Variant& value)
{
    switch (value.GetType())
    {
    case VAR_NONE:
        return true;

    case VAR_INT:
        return WriteInt(value.GetInt());

    case VAR_BOOL:
        return WriteBool(value.GetBool());

    case VAR_FLOAT:
        return WriteFloat(value.GetFloat());

    case VAR_VECTOR2:
        return WriteVector2(value.GetVector2());

    case VAR_VECTOR3:
        return WriteVector3(value.GetVector3());

    case VAR_VECTOR4:
        return WriteVector4(value.GetVector4());

    case VAR_QUATERNION:
        return WriteQuaternion(value.GetQuaternion());

    case VAR_COLOR:
        return WriteColor(value.GetColor());

    case VAR_STRING:
        return WriteString(value.GetString());

    case VAR_BUFFER:
        return WriteBuffer(value.GetBuffer());

    // Serializing pointers is not supported. Write null
    case VAR_VOIDPTR:
    case VAR_PTR:
        return WriteUInt(0);

    case VAR_RESOURCEREF:
        return WriteResourceRef(value.GetResourceRef());

    case VAR_RESOURCEREFLIST:
        return WriteResourceRefList(value.GetResourceRefList());

    case VAR_VARIANTVECTOR:
        return WriteVariantVector(value.GetVariantVector());

    case VAR_VARIANTMAP:
        return WriteVariantMap(value.GetVariantMap());

    case VAR_INTRECT:
        return WriteIntRect(value.GetIntRect());

    case VAR_INTVECTOR2:
        return WriteIntVector2(value.GetIntVector2());

    case VAR_MATRIX3:
        return WriteMatrix3(value.GetMatrix3());

    case VAR_MATRIX3X4:
        return WriteMatrix3x4(value.GetMatrix3x4());

    case VAR_MATRIX4:
        return WriteMatrix4(value.GetMatrix4());

    default:
        return false;
    }
}
